As a candidate, we encourage you to have an open dialogue with a member of our HR Team and ask compensation related questions, including pay details for this role.Job Description:The Strategic & Editorial Content (SEC) Group is TD Wealth's content centre of excellence,responsible for developing editorial and strategic content that highlights the depth and breadthof TD Wealth expertise and showcases our thought leadership to TD clients and the world. Theteam is comprised of talented content professionals who bring together their editorial,production, creative and technical expertise to create industry-leading financial content acrossdigital and broadcast streams. SEC properties include: MoneyTalk "Brought to you by TD,"available at www.moneytalkgo.com and distributed across multiple TD ecosystems, MoneyTalkLive, streamed daily through TD WebBroker, and MoneyTalk on BNN Bloomberg, broadcastweekly on CTV properties, as well as live and original programming on multiple radio stationsand various social channels each week.We're looking for a talented Creative leader who thrives in a fast-paced environment, is passionate about how people experience content, wants to move quickly from ideas to delivery, and builds and leads processes to work with all collaborators, partners and stakeholders.The Role: Art Director, Creative ServicesWe are seeking for a seasoned hands-on Art Director to work closely with our editorial producers, writers, senior designers & illustrators, developers, and videographers.
